A Multi-Agent Reinforcement Learning-Based Data-Driven Method for Home Energy Management.
Abstract
This paper proposes a novel framework for home energy management (HEM) based on reinforcement learning in achieving efficient home-based demand response (DR). The concerned hour-ahead energy consumption scheduling problem is duly formulated as a finite Markov decision process (FMDP) with discrete time steps.
